The Oakland Teaching Fellows program is a highly selective, innovative path to becoming a teacher and making a difference in Oakland public schools. We focus on recruiting individuals from diverse backgrounds who will use their knowledge, experience, and records of achievement to positively change the lives of students in Oakland.

We seek the most talented and accomplished among you to teach science, math, special education, PE, bilingual education (k-12), and Spanish. Neither prior coursework in education nor past teaching experience required.


Benefits:

Guaranteed full time teaching position in high-need subject areas Path to earn a California Teaching Credential while teaching Full teacher’s salary and benefits Paid summer training that will prepare you to make immediate gains in student achievement Network of talented, committed new teachers


Qualifications:

Bachelor’s degree Minimum 2.75 GPA Legal authorization to work in the U.S. Strong record of achievement, critical thinking, and communication skills Clear commitment to Oakland’s students
